Stealth and concealment techniques
Stealth and concealment techniques are vital components of successful jungle reconnaissance and patrol methods in warfare. Effective concealment minimizes the risk of detection by the enemy, ensuring mission continuity and team safety.
Key methods include the use of natural terrain features, such as dense foliage, trees, and terrain irregularities, to hide movement. Camouflage clothing and face paint are also essential to blend with the environment and reduce visual signatures.
Operators often employ slow, deliberate movements to avoid noise and disturbances that could alert adversaries. Techniques such as treading softly, maintaining low profiles, and avoiding unnecessary interruptions are critical.
To enhance concealment, patrols often utilize tools like natural cover and shadow to their advantage. They also coordinate movements to maintain unity and prevent detection gaps, especially during night operations or in dense vegetation.

Sonar and ground surveillance equipment
Sonar and ground surveillance equipment are vital tools in jungle reconnaissance and patrol methods, especially within challenging terrains. Sonar systems emit sound waves that bounce off objects, providing real-time data on submerged hazards or hidden structures. This technology is particularly advantageous in swampy or riverine environments, where water-based threats may exist.
Ground surveillance equipment includes a variety of sensors and devices designed to detect movement, heat signatures, and sound in dense foliage. Infrared cameras and seismic sensors can monitor large areas silently, reducing the risk of detection. These systems enhance the ability to gather critical intelligence without exposing patrol units to unnecessary danger.
While sonar and ground surveillance technology greatly enhance operational capabilities, their effectiveness can be affected by terrain and environmental conditions. Dense foliage, heavy rain, and terrain complexity may limit data accuracy. Nevertheless, integrating these technologies into jungle reconnaissance remains a strategic advantage, improving situational awareness and operational success in difficult terrain.

Tactical Formations and Patrolling Patterns
Tactical formations and patrolling patterns are fundamental components of jungle reconnaissance and patrol methods, enabling units to effectively cover terrain while minimizing detection risks. Formation choices depend on terrain, threat level, and operational objectives, often favoring dispersed or linear arrangements to enhance stealth.
During patrols, formations such as wedge, echelon, and line are employed to maintain security and facilitate quick response to threats. These formations improve situational awareness, allowing the team to scan the environment and observe potential dangers from multiple angles.
Patrolling patterns are designed to optimize coverage and reduce vulnerabilities. Techniques such as bounding overwatch, where one team moves while the other provides security, balance movement speed with safety. Precise coordination ensures seamless communication and swift reactions to hostiles or obstacles.
Effective use of tactical formations and patrolling patterns safeguards reconnaissance teams from ambushes and supports covert operations in dense jungle terrain. Adapting formations to the environment and mission specifics enhances operational success and personnel safety.

Identifying threats and avoiding detection
In jungle reconnaissance, effectively identifying threats is critical for mission success and personnel safety. Recognizing signs of enemy presence, such as footprints, discarded equipment, or unusual sounds, allows teams to assess potential dangers promptly. Continuous environmental assessment helps in detecting covert enemy movements or traps.
Avoiding detection relies heavily on mastering stealth and concealment techniques. Reconnaissance teams employ natural cover, minimize noise, and use camouflage to blend seamlessly into their environment. Movement patterns are adapted to reduce visibility, such as traveling during low-visibility periods like dawn or dusk.
Strategic communication is vital for maintaining situational awareness without risking exposure. Teams utilize silent signaling methods and secure channels to coordinate and share intelligence discreetly. Monitoring enemy signals or movements while evading their sensors enhances operational security.
Overall, a combination of vigilant threat recognition, disciplined concealment practices, and covert communication strategies optimizes the ability to identify threats and avoid detection effectively in complex jungle terrains.

Challenges and Limitations in Jungle Reconnaissance
Jungle reconnaissance presents unique challenges due to the complex and unpredictable environment. Dense foliage and limited visibility significantly hinder movement and observation, increasing the risk of detection by hostile forces.
The terrain often complicates navigation and endurance, demanding specialized training and equipment. Additionally, harsh weather conditions such as heavy rain, humidity, and heat affect both personnel and technological assets, reducing operational effectiveness.
Technological limitations also emerge in dense jungle terrain. Ground surveillance equipment and drones may struggle with signal loss or obstruction, diminishing their reliability. These constraints necessitate adaptive strategies and rigorous planning to mitigate risks during jungle patrols and reconnaissance missions.
